High-end floating bootstrap power supply design, with a withstand voltage of up to 600V
-
integrated with three independent half-bridge drivers
-
compatible with 5V and 3.3V input voltages
-
maximum frequency support of 500KHz
-
low-end VCC voltage range of 4.5V - 20V
-
output current capability of IO +1.2A/-1.4A
-
built-in dead-time control circuit
-
built-in latch function, completely eliminating simultaneous conduction of upper and lower tube outputs
-
HIN input channel high-level effective, controlling high-end HO output
-
LIN input channel high-level effective, controlling low-end LO output
-
package form: SOP20
-
lead-free and halogen-free, compliant with ROHS standards.
-
Three-phase DC brushless motor driver
EG2334 is a high cost-effective high-power MOS transistor and IGBT transistor gate drive dedicated chip, which integrates logic signal input processing circuit, dead zone control circuit, lockout circuit, level shift circuit, pulse filtering circuit, and output drive circuit. The high-end working voltage can reach 600V, and the low-end VCC power supply voltage range is wide from 4.5V to 20V. The chip has a locking function to prevent the output power transistors from conducting simultaneously. The input channels HIN and LIN have built-in pull-down resistors, which keep the upper and lower power MOS transistors in a closed state when the input is suspended. The output current capability is IO+1.2A -1.4A.
